**Alert: Rebalancer drift — SpokeShift**

SpokeShift's rebalancing optimizer is assigning van routes against stale dock counts when the Kestrel feed lags more than 4 minutes. Result: trucks dispatched to already-full stations in the Harborline district. Alert fires when feed lag exceeds threshold twice in 15 minutes. Mitigation: restart the feed consumer, verify dock deltas. Full runbook and escalation order are on the internal page here.

runbook for badug-kadup: https://confluence.zemvarlabs.internal/projects/browse/display/projects/bd1b

## Break-Glass Access: Quillscale Autoscaler

The Quillscale queue-depth autoscaler may be manually overridden only during a declared incident. Security reviewers should confirm each break-glass event is logged, time-boxed to thirty minutes, and countersigned by the on-call lead. Overrides are applied through the sealed console, which accepts the recovery passphrase shown below.

vault phrase of tawig-taduf = zorath-oliwyn

Ticket #4412 — Vault locked during reset-flow revamp. Heads up, future folks: while migrating Quillbank's password reset flow to the new Lanternpost service, the staging vault auto-locked after three failed token swaps. Totally expected behavior, just annoying. Marva re-sealed it until the revamp ships. To unlock for testing, use the recovery passphrase below.

unlock words, fahop-yageg: ralwyn-kelath